Stock Market Recap

Indian benchmark indices fluctuated between gains and losses as gains in Reliance Industries and SBI were offset by the losses in Bharti Airtel, Bajaj Finance and Power Grid. The Sensex closed 373.76 points, or 0.48%, higher at 78,954.76. The Nifty 50 ended 11.35 points, or 0.05%, higher at 24,636.

US Market Wrap

Treasury futures slipped as a rise in energy prices rekindled concerns that the Federal Reserve may have to keep interest rates higher for longer. The US 10-year Treasury yield held at 4.68% after rising seven basis points in the previous session, while the dollar strengthened against most Group-of-10 currencies as higher yield expectations boosted demand for the greenback.

S&P 500 futures were little changed as of 10:06 a.m. Tokyo time, while Australia's S&P/ASX 200 declined 0.2%, according to Bloomberg.

Asian Market Wrap

Asian stock markets traded mixed on Friday as investors weighed another rise in crude oil prices amid uncertainty over the Strait of Hormuz and awaited the U.S. jobs report for cues on the outlook for interest rates. Japan's Nikkei 225 fell 0.76%, while Australia's ASX 200 declined 0.31%. China's Shanghai Composite slipped 0.03%. South Korea's Kospi bucked the broader weakness and gained 0.52%.

Commodity Check

Oil extended gains after a report that Iran attacked “hostile targets” in the Strait of Hormuz, with Tehran seeking to bar US ships from the critical waterway in a deal with Oman. Brent rose above $83 a barrel, after surging almost 4% in the previous session, while West Texas Intermediate was near $78.

Gold moved in a narrow range as traders assessed the impact of a reported Iranian attack in the Strait of Hormuz on the Federal Reserve's path for interest rates. Bullion was trading around $4,240 an ounce, after ending the previous session down 0.2%.

Spot gold fell 0.1% to $4,233.95 an ounce at 8:52 a.m. in Singapore. Silver fell 0.5% to $61.25 an ounce. Platinum and palladium also declined, according to Bloomberg.

US Market Recap

U.S. stocks traded mixed in early trading on Thursday, with the Nasdaq slipping as sharp declines in semiconductor and technology stocks offset gains in the broader market.

As of 9:44 a.m. EDT, the Nasdaq Composite was down 17.51 points, or 0.07%, at 26,345.93. The S&P 500 edged up 7.44 points, or 0.10%, to 7,730.99, while the Dow Jones Industrial Average gained 83.63 points, or 0.15%, to 54,432.75.

Stocks In News

  • Deepak Nitrite: Deepak Chem Tech commissioned its MIBK/MIBC plant at Dahej on August 6, 2026. The project involved a capex of about Rs. 735 crore.

  • Kaveri Seeds: ITAT Hyderabad will hear the company's appeal on November 2, 2026, regarding a Rs. 69.58 crore tax demand for AY24.

  • Panorama Studios: Panorama Studios Inflight LLP signed an exclusive worldwide airborne rights agreement for the Malayalam film Paisawala.

  • Reliance Communications: RCOM's Singapore step-down subsidiary has been struck off from the Singapore company registry.

  • Grasim Industries: Repaid Rs. 750 crore of commercial paper in full on August 6, 2026. Outstanding commercial paper is now nil.

  • Polyplex Corporation: AGPH's tender offer closed on August 5, 2026, with 162,812,291 Polyplex shares, representing an 18.09% stake, tendered and acquired.

  • Allied Blenders: Approved expansion at Moradabad, including a 66 million bulk litre distillery by Q1 FY29 and increasing bottling capacity to 13 million cases by Q3 FY28.

  • GTL Infrastructure: Appointed Jayant Bhimanwar as Whole-time Director.

  • HG Infra Engineering: Invested Rs. 33.8 crore in H.G. Gujarat BESS Private Limited through a rights issue.

  • Waaree Energies: Waaree Clean Energy Solutions incorporated WH Clean Mobility Systems on August 4, 2026, to focus on clean mobility solutions.

  • Kajaria Ceramics: Acquired 44,11,764 CCPS of KBPL from Aravali for Rs. 50 crore on August 6, 2026.

  • Shivalik Bimetal Controls: Rajeev Ranjan resigned as CFO, effective October 31, 2026.

  • TVS Motor Company: Launched the TVS iQube in Kenya, becoming the first Indian OEM to introduce a premium electric scooter in Africa.

  • Persistent Systems: Launched a EUR 81 per share takeover offer for all Nagarro shares. The acceptance period runs until September 17, 2026.

  • Sandur Manganese & Iron Ores: Approved incorporation of two wholly owned subsidiaries, Royal Sandur Hospitality and Royal Sandur Academy, with initial capital of Rs. 1 crore each.

  • CESC: Subsidiary Purvah received an LoA from SECI for a 175 MW wind project at a tariff of Rs. 3.85/kWh for 25 years.

  • Powerica: Received an LoA from SECI for a 100 MW wind project in Gujarat at a tariff of Rs. 3.85/kWh for 25 years.

  • Coal India: Declared the preferred bidder for the Gadadharpur iron ore block in Odisha, with estimated resources of 288 million tonnes.

  • J. Kumar Infraprojects: Received an LoA for a Rs. 990.16 crore EPC contract to build a cricket stadium in Bengaluru over 36 months.

  • HCLTech: Named an OpenAI Advanced Partner.

  • RailTel: Secured an LoA from North Western Railway for a 4x48F OFC project worth Rs. 37.67 crore, to be executed by August 6, 2027.

  • Dabur India: Received a US FDA warning letter dated July 24, 2026, for its Silvassa plant. Domestic operations remain unaffected.

  • Globus Spirits: Closed its QIP and allotted 23.81 lakh shares at Rs. 840 per share, raising about Rs. 200 crore.

  • Swan Defence and Heavy Industries: NCLT Ahmedabad approved the merger of Triumph Offshore Private Limited with the company. The scheme becomes effective upon filing the order with the Registrar of Companies.

  • EIH: Deferred the reopening of The Oberoi Grand, Kolkata, to September 2028 due to construction restrictions, structural restoration and expanded renovation work.

  • Aegis Logistics: Signed a framework agreement with AVTL for a 51,998 MT propane tank at JNPA. The company will receive Rs. 142.5 crore.

  • SCL: Signed a framework agreement with KCPL for storage tanks worth Rs. 37.17 crore.

  • CreditAccess Grameen: Promoter CreditAccess India B.V. sold 36,57,500 shares, representing a 2.28% stake, through a block deal on August 6, 2026.

  • Interarch Building Solutions:

    • Approved a joint venture with ER Steel Inc., Canada, with an initial investment of Rs. 80 crore for the OWSJ business in North America.

    • Approved a 1:5 stock split.

    • Approved raising up to Rs. 250 crore through a QIP.

  • Grasim Industries: Issued a Letter of Awareness to ICICI Bank for Domsjo Fabriker AB, Sweden, relating to USD 39 million credit facilities. The letter does not create any repayment obligation, guarantee or financial commitment for Grasim.

  • Prism Johnson: India Ratings upgraded its NCDs and bank loans to IND AA-/Positive. Commercial paper rating reaffirmed at IND A1+.

  • BLS E-Services: Appointed Ashish Misra as Deputy CEO and Senior Management Personnel with effect from August 6, 2026.

  • GlaxoSmithKline Pharmaceuticals: Received a tax refund of Rs. 52 crore on August 6, 2026. Interest income of Rs. 42.09 crore will be recognised in the P&L.

  • Britannia Industries: Appointed Sonny Iqbal as an Additional Independent Director for a five-year term from August 8, 2026.

  • KSB: Approved a Rs. 40 crore investment to expand the Shirwal plant's capacity by about 20% through a new manufacturing shed, funded via internal accruals.

  • Healthcare Global Enterprises: Approved an additional investment of up to Rs. 16 crore in wholly owned subsidiary HCG Rajkot Hospitals LLP.

  • Transrail Lighting: Re-appointed Digambar Chunnilal Bagde as Executive Chairman.

  • TCI Express: Re-appointed Chander Agarwal as Managing Director.

  • JSW Energy: ICRA assigned an [ICRA] A (Stable) rating to the debt facilities of JSW Renewable Energy Dolvi Three Limited.

  • GPT Infraprojects: Wholly owned subsidiary Alcon Builders emerged as the L1 bidder for an Eastern Railway signalling contract worth Rs. 72.5 crore.

  • Religare Enterprises: Material subsidiary Care Health Insurance allotted Rs. 200 crore of 10% subordinated NCDs.
